A pump delivers the mobile phase via a column filled with a stationary phase. An autosampler injects the sample onto the column. The stationary phase separates the sample compounds or analytes. A detector measures the analytes soon after separation and elution with the column.

Reverse phase HPLC employs a polar mobile phase and a non-polar stationary phase. Reverse phase HPLC is the commonest liquid chromatography system used. The R groups normally attached to the siloxane for reverse phase HPLC are: C8, C18,or any hydrocarbon.
